The list of names being linked with a move to FC Barcelona continues to grow by the day. Following reports of Van de Beek potentially heading to the Camp Nou, there's another Dutchman being linked today: Georginio Wijnaldum. The 29-year-old Liverpool midfielder has obviously worked with Ronald Koeman in the national team.
According to Dutch outlet 'AD', Koeman has asked Wijnaldum not to sign a new deal at Anfield so he would be available on a free transfer in 2021. This means he could be available for a cheaper than usual price, or for free if he sees out his final 12 months with Liverpool.
Wijnaldum was the Liverpool hero two seasons ago when he scored a brace at Anfield to help eliminate Barcelona from the Champions League.
